Pierre Fraysse: Pierre (known as Peters) Fraysse is a French chef, inventor of the so-called "American" recipe. Originally from Sète, Peters Fraysse returned from America where he had spent time in Chicago as a chef, founded on his return to Paris the restaurant "Peter's".
